How We Remove Water from Crawl Spaces

Our team’s process for crawl space water removal is designed to reduce disruption and increase results. Here’s what you can expect:

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technician visits your property to assess the extent of the water damage and create a customized plan to address your specific needs. We’ll also identify any potential sources of water accumulation and recommend prevention strategies to avoid future issues.

Step 2: Water Removal and Drying

Using industrial-grade equipment, our technician will remove standing water from your crawl space and dry the area using specialized drying equipment. This process typically takes 3-5 days dep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once the area is dry, our technician will thoroughly clean and sanitize the crawl space to prevent mold growth and bacterial contamination. This step is critical to ensuring a safe and healthy living space.

Step 4: Damage Repair and Prevention

Our technician will then identify and repair any damaged areas, including wood, insulation, and other structural parts. We’ll also provide recommendations for preventing future water accumulation and damage.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up

Upon completion of the water removal process, our technician will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the area is safe and dry. We’ll also clean up any equipment and materials used during the process.

Warning Signs You Need Crawl Space Water Removal

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and potential health hazards. Our team is here to help you identify and address these issues before they become major problems.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can show mold growth in your crawl space. If you notice persistent musty smells, don’t ignore them investigate the source and take action to prevent further damage.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on walls, floors, or ceilings can show water accumulation in your crawl space. If you notice these signs, act quickly to prevent further damage and ensure a safe living space.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or accumulation in your crawl space. If you notice these signs, investigate the source and take action to prevent further damage.

Unpleasant Moisture or Humidity

Unpleasant moisture or humidity in your crawl space can lead to mold growth and structural damage. If you notice these signs, take action to prevent further damage and ensure a safe living space.

Visible Water Damage or Leaks

Visible water damage or leaks in your crawl space can lead to costly repairs and potential health hazards. If you notice these signs, act quickly to prevent further damage and ensure a safe living space.

High Utility Bills

High utility bills can show water accumulation or damage in your crawl space. If you notice these signs, investigate the source and take action to prevent further damage and lower your utility bills.

Crawl Space Water Removal Cost in Laurel, MD

The cost of crawl space water removal in Laurel, MD can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500 with factors such as equipment usage, drying time, and more damage repair affecting the final price.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Removal and Drying $500-$1,500 Equipment usage, drying time, and more damage repair.
Damage Repair and Prevention $500-$2,000 Scope of damage, materials needed, and labor costs.
Final Inspection and Cleanup $100-$500 Equipment usage, labor costs, and materials needed.
Total Cost $1,100-$5,000 All services combined, including equipment usage, labor costs, and materials needed.

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and free estimates are available for your convenience.
